Ore mining and environmental technology information network

Objective

The overall objective of this project is to raise public awareness and understanding for ore mining technologies, and introduce the challenges environmental scientists encounter when facing with mining-related environmental issues in the EU and Associated countries. Public interest will be addressed jointly by a unique mixture of Eastern, Central, and Westem European scientists with teams comprising of experts with background in mining technology, environmental engineering, earth sciences and communication. The final deliverable of this project is a self-sustained network on ore mining technologies and associated environmental issues.
